ChatGPT and Gemini Both Cross 1 Billion Monthly Users
The Verge AI · rss · 2026-08-12
Google CEO Sundar Pichai announced that Gemini has surpassed 1 billion monthly active users, making it Google's fastest-growing product ever and the 14th Google product to hit this milestone.
Meanwhile, OpenAI quietly confirmed that ChatGPT also crossed the 1 billion user mark. External data suggested ChatGPT reached this milestone as early as June, though OpenAI only disclosed it in an otherwise unremarkable blog post on August 6th.
